Mobility vans, also known as wheelchair-accessible vans, are specially designed vehicles that provide transportation for individuals with mobility challenges. Here are some key points about mobility vans:
Features of Mobility Vans
Accessibility: Equipped with ramps or lifts to facilitate easy entry and exit for wheelchair users.
Securement Systems: Designed with tie-downs and restraints to safely secure wheelchairs during transit.
Customizable Options: Available in various configurations, including side-entry and rear-entry models, to meet individual needs.
Benefits
Independence: Enable users to travel without relying on public transportation, enhancing personal freedom.
Cost Savings: Owning a mobility van can be more economical than regular wheelchair transport services.
Safety Regulations
Compliance with ADA: Must adhere to the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) standards.
Regular Maintenance: Ensures all accessibility features remain functional and safe for users.
Considerations for Purchase
Vehicle Condition: Assess the condition, especially if buying used.
Type of Modifications: Understand the extent of modifications required for wheelchair access.
Mobility vans are essential for improving the quality of life for individuals with disabilities, providing safe and reliable transportation options. If you need more specific information or have a particular aspect in mind, feel free to ask!

Safety regulations for mobility vans are crucial to ensure the safety and accessibility of passengers who use wheelchairs and other mobility devices. Here are some key examples of these regulations:
Securement Systems: Mobility vans must be equipped with securement systems that include four tie-down belts, a lap belt, and a shoulder belt to ensure the safety of passengers in wheelchairs during transit. Proper securement is vital to prevent movement and potential injury while the vehicle is in motion [1].
Ramp Specifications: If a wheelchair ramp is included in the mobility van, it must adhere to specific requirements. These include a slope ratio of 1:12, a flat area of at least five feet at both the top and bottom of the ramp, a minimum width of 36 inches, and handrails that are at least 34 inches tall on either side [1].
Accessibility Compliance: All vehicles used in public transit must comply with the U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T) regulations under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). This includes ensuring that vehicle lifts and ramps are in proper working condition and that they accommodate individuals and their mobility devices [2].
Maintenance of Accessibility Features: Transit agencies are required to maintain all accessibility features, such as lifts and ramps, in operative condition. Regular maintenance checks must be conducted, and any damaged features must be repaired promptly [2].
Driver Training: Drivers of mobility vans must be trained in the proper use of accessibility equipment and securement systems to ensure the safety of passengers. This training is essential for providing accessible service [2].
Passenger Rights: Passengers using mobility devices must be allowed to disembark at any designated stop unless there are legitimate safety concerns that prevent the safe use of the lift or ramp [2].
These regulations are designed to enhance the safety and accessibility of mobility vans, ensuring that individuals with disabilities can travel safely and independently.
Mobility vans, also known as wheelchair-accessible vans, play a crucial role in enhancing the independence and mobility of individuals with disabilities. Here are some key points about mobility vans based on recent articles:
Importance of Mobility Vans
Independence: Wheelchair-accessible vans provide a significant level of independence for individuals with mobility limitations. They allow users to travel without relying on public transportation or expensive private services, which can often be unreliable or inaccessible [3].
Cost-Effectiveness: The average cost for non-emergency wheelchair transport can be quite high, often around $150 for a one-way trip. Owning here a mobility van can alleviate this financial burden, especially for those with regular medical appointments [3].
Accessibility: These vans are specifically designed to accommodate wheelchairs, featuring ramps or lifts for easy entry and exit. This design ensures that individuals can travel safely and comfortably [2].
Considerations When Purchasing a Mobility Van
Condition: When buying a used wheelchair van, it's essential to assess its condition, especially since these vehicles undergo significant structural modifications [1].
Type of Entry: Buyers should consider whether they prefer a side entry or rear entry ramp, as each has its advantages depending on the user's needs and preferences [1].
Cost of Conversion: Understanding the costs involved in converting a standard vehicle into a wheelchair-accessible one is crucial for potential buyers [1].
Safety Features
Wheelchair Securement: Proper securement systems are vital for ensuring the safety of passengers. This includes using tiedowns and restraints to keep the wheelchair stable during transit [2].
Driver Training: Drivers of mobility vans should be trained in the proper methods for securing wheelchairs and ensuring passenger safety [2].
Community Support
Organizations like All Things Possible Medical Fundraising are dedicated to providing wheelchair-accessible vans to families in need, helping them regain their mobility and independence [3].
In summary, mobility vans are essential for enhancing the quality of life for individuals with disabilities, providing them with the freedom to travel independently and safely.
